Pressers, Textile, Garment, and Related Materials Salary in Wisconsin
In Wisconsin, pressers, textile, garment, and related materials earn a median of $35,250 per year.

How Wisconsin compares
Refit analysis ·In Wisconsin, pressers, textile, garment, and related materials earn a median of $35,250 — 4% above the national median of $33,880. Locally the range runs $29,890 to $43,800. About 630 people hold this role in the state.
Refit analysis ·Wisconsin ranks #9 of 47 states for pressers, textile, garment, and related materials pay — roughly the 83th percentile among states. That trails the top-paying state (Washington, $38,260) by 9%. State employment of about 630 also shapes how competitive local openings are.
